CRIMSON CRUMBLE BARS



Crimson Crumble Bars image

Baking is my favorite pastime. These moist cranberry bars have a refreshing sweet-tart taste and a pleasant crumble topping. They're great as a snack or anytime treat. -Paula Eriksen Of Palm Harbor, Florida

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 45m

Yield 2 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 cup sugar
2 teaspoons cornstarch
2 cups fresh or frozen cranberries
1 can (8 ounces) unsweetened crushed pineapple, undrained
1 cup all-purpose flour
2/3 cup old-fashioned oats
2/3 cup packed br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up cold butter, cubed
1/2 cup chopped pecans

Steps:

  • In a large saucepan, combine the sugar, cornstarch, cranberries and pineapple; bring to a boil, stirring often.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 10-15 minutes or until the berries pop. Remove from the heat., In a large bowl, combine the flour, oats, brown sugar and salt. Cut in butter until m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Stir in pecans. Set aside 1-1/2 cups for topping. , Press remaining crumb mixture onto the bottom of a 13-in. x 9-in. baking pan coated with cooking spray. Bake at 350° for 8-10 minutes or until firm; cool for 10 minutes., Pour fruit filling over crust. Sprinkle with reserved crumb mixture. Bake for 25-30 minutes longer or until golden brown. Cool on a wire rack.

CRIMSON CRUMBLE BARS



Crimson Crumble Bars image

Enjoy this fruity and nutty bar made with oats.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Dessert

Time 1h55m

Yield 36

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 cups fresh or frozen cranberries
1 cup granulated sugar
2 teaspoons cornstarch
1 can (8 oz) crushed pineapple in unsweetened juice, undrained
1 cup Gold Medal™ whole wheat or all-purpose flour
2 cups old-fashioned oats
2/3 cup packed br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up butter or margarine, cut into pieces
1/2 cup chopped pecans, if desired

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350°F. Spray 13x9-inch pan with cooking spray. In 2-quart saucepan, mix cranberries, granulated sugar, cornstarch and pineapple. Heat to boiling, stirring frequently; reduce heat. Cover; simmer 10 to 15 minutes, stirring occasionally, until cranberries pop and sauce is translucent.
  • Meanwhile, in large bowl, mix flour, oats, brown sugar and salt. Cut in butter, using pastry blender or fork, until crumbly. Stir in pecans. Reserve 1 cup mixture for topping. Press remaining crumb mixture in pan.
  • Pour fruit mixture over crust. Sprinkle with reserved crumb mixture.
  • Bake 28 to 32 minutes or until top is golden brown. Cool completely on cooling rack, at least 1 hour. For bars, cut into 6 rows by 6 rows.

Tips:

  • Mise en Place: Before you start baking, make sure you have all of your ingredients and equipment ready. This will help you stay organized and avoid any scrambling.
  • Use High-Quality Ingredients: The quality of your ingredients will greatly impact the taste of your crimson crumble bars. Use fresh, ripe fruit and high-quality butter and flour.
  • Chill the Dough: Chilling the dough before baking will help it to hold its shape and prevent it from spreading too much in the oven.
  • Don't Overmix the Dough: Overmixing the dough will make it tough. Mix it just until the ingredients are combined.
  • Bake the Bars Until Golden Brown: The bars are done baking when the crust is golden brown and the filling is bubbling.
  • Let the Bars Cool Completely: Before cutting and serving the bars, let them cool completely. This will help them to set and hold their shape.
